The SEO and Analytics Angle

Here’s another layer that most people don’t consider.

Sometimes random strings are tied to tracking parameters, session IDs, or campaign codes. If they’re improperly configured, they can create:

For SEO professionals, that’s a nightmare.

Search engines prefer clean, structured URLs and consistent signals. If identifiers like 48ft3ajx accidentally become part of public-facing URLs, they can fragment ranking signals across multiple versions of the same page.

It’s subtle. But over time, it adds up.

Developers and Placeholder Culture

Here’s something I learned working alongside product teams: developers use placeholders constantly. Random IDs. Temporary labels. Dummy data.

Most of the time, those are stripped out before release.

But occasionally, something slips through.

It might be harmless — just a leftover reference — but when exposed publicly, it can confuse users who assume it’s intentional.

In my experience, this is one of the most common reasons behind odd strings surfacing online. Not sabotage. Not secret tracking. Just unfinished cleanup.
